Anyone know how to make a solid car dolly with casters, to support a TR shell after a frame drop? What would be the best mounting points on the body?

R
 
this is mine...

Used a set of wheel dollies, 4 jackstands, and some angle irons.

I welded the jackstands to the dollies and the angle to the the jackstands then bolted the angle irons to the front and rear mount locations. Works like a charm and was cheap and affordable!

glad I could help - i was just trying to use some things I had available - ive attached a couple more pics that are a little bit more clear on how i did it, these were on my comp at work - its a bit hard to tell but on the back i had to weld to additional angle irons to the top of the jackstand and then used wood blocks as spacers ( needed a bit more height ) and shot a bolt through the angle and wood spacer into the body mount
